The total tuition fees of studying PG Diploma at Sadhna Academy of Media Studies is INR 75,000. The course is offered for a duration of one year and candidates must complete their graduation with a valid score to take admission in the course. It is offered in three specialisations such as: - PG Diploma in Mass Communication (PGDMC), Advertising and Public Relations and Print and Electronic Journalism.

Yes, students awaiting their graduation result can also apply for admission in Sadhna Academy of Media Studies. The students are required to submit the latest marksheets and a declaration of pending final result. Provisional admission can be provided on this basis and will be confirmed only after the final results are submitted. This helps the candidate to secure a seat in the academy.

The documents that are required for filling the application form of SAMS include: -

  •   Class 10 and 12 marksheets
  •   Graduation marksheet/degree
  •   Passport size photo
  •   ID proof
  •   Transfer or character certificate
  •   Additional certificates and achievements

Sadhna Academy for Media Studies offers UGC recognised degree and diploma courses in the media industry.
UGC Approved Degree courses provided by Sadhna Academy are following
1.Bachelor of journalism in Mass communication
2.Master of journalism in Mass communication
3.PG Diploma in Mass Communication
4.PG Diploma In Advertising and public relations
5.P.G Diploma In print and electronic journalism
